Key Features to Look for

Choosing an editing software hinges on identifying key features that align with your unique needs and style.

  1. Powerful performance: Go for software with a quick render time, reducing your waiting time.
  2. User-friendly interface: Opt for a program that’s easy to navigate, easing the editing process.
  3. Wide range of effects: Seek a variety with transitions, 3D effects, and filters, adding dynamism to your video.
  4. Audio mastery: You need software that offers full control over the audio track, enhancing the viewer’s auditory experience.
  5. Export options: Ensure the software supports several formats and resolutions, maximizing screen compatibility.

For instance, Adobe Premiere Pro and Sony Vegas Pro offer the abovementioned features. They provide an expansive library of effects, a friendly user interface, and a variety of audio-editing tools. Both support 4k resolution and diverse exporting formats.

Software Ease of Use

Understanding that beginners might find complex tools daunting, it’s pertinent to consider the ease of use in an editing software. Industry-leading options include HitFilm Express and iMovie. Both maintain intuitive interfaces and offer straightforward operations, conducive for someone stepping into the YouTube gaming scene.

HitFilm Express, for example, has a workspace that’s easily customizable to suit individual preferences. Its main features, such as trimmers, mixers and viewers, are neatly laid out, essentially easing the process of video editing. Similarly, iMovie’s simplified yet powerful interface allows users to conveniently drag and drop video clips, with tools like split screen and picture-in-picture readily available.

Budget-Friendly Options

While cost remains a significant deciding factor for many beginner content creators, there are budget-friendly software options that don’t compromise on necessary features. DaVinci Resolve and Lightworks stand as prime examples.

DaVinci Resolve, for instance, comes with a free version packed with advanced features. Notably, it offers a professional 8K editing system, visual effects, motion graphics, color correction, and audio post-production tools.
